jeremy-mayfldSuspended Sprint Cup driver Jeremy Mayfield is set to learn the hard way, that the liberty of free speech also comes with the fine print of the involved susceptibility of free speakers to get sued for shooting off their mouths. Case in point being, his step mom Lisa Mayfield’s recent lawsuit, that seeks damages for public statements made by Jeremy in the context of his civil suit against NASCAR.

The legal equivalent of “Watch your mouth”, the defamation suit alleges false, defamatory and slanderous statements made by Jeremy. The suit seeks compensatory damages in the excess of $10,000, punitive damages to the tune of $ 10,000 and above, along with unspecified damages that are left open to the discretion of the court.

For the record, Lisa Mayfield, whose corroboration of NASCAR’s allegation of substance-abuse by Jeremy Mayfield, had prompted his hate campaign against his step mom, who he had called “a whore” and publicly accused of killing his father, had in her NASCAR related testimony against Mayfield Jr, testified to having seen him use methamphetamine on numerous occasions amounting to about 30 times.

The testimony of course, had been significantly instrumental in securing NASCAR’s requested reinstatement of Jeremy Mayfield’s indefinite ban for violation of their substance abuse policy, and had initiated the mud-slinging contest, with Jeremy lashing back publicly at his stepmother.
